If you wish to know how to be a football coach to a high standard, there are particular skills and qualities that you need to have. Probably, one of the most fundamental qualities of a football coach is leadership. It is the coach's duty to run the team, handle the players and maintain a great performance; every one of which require a strong set of leadership skills. For example, a coach should be able to clearly and concisely communicate info, directions and feedback to the players, they should create individual and group training programs for the players, and they have to likewise be able to make hard decisions under pressure. For example, in high-stakes football matches, often a coach will need to step in and make difficult decisions for the benefit of the entire team, such as placing certain players on the bench.

Lots of people think that being an excellent coach is only vital on game day, but this is not the case. As a matter of fact, one of the greatest responsibilities of a football coach is performing the training sessions. For example, coaches design and implement training sessions for the whole team to carry out together, as well as individual plans for each player. Besides, players have different strengths and weaknesses, and a great football coach pays equal attention to everybody on the pitch, spots any kind of weak points in the players and creates a targeted plan of action to help them improve. These training programs might entail particular football training drills that concentrate on one element of the match, whether it be shooting or dribbling for instance. They keep an eye on the players, give them constructive feedback and supply them with the resources, abilities and techniques they need to become an even better player. In the weeks and days leading up to the game, the football coach will analyse the opponent, pinpoint their strengths and weaknesses, and then come up with a tactical, calculated and strategic game plan, including player positioning, formations and substitutions.

Generally-speaking, becoming a football coach entails a lot of responsibility, whether you are coaching at a professional, semi-pro or amateur level. This is why one of the most vital tips for coaching football is to work on your capability to stay cool, calm and collected. Game day can be a lot of stress, particularly when you have the opposition breathing down your neck and your team is on a losing streak. In spite of exactly how impassioned or emotional you may feel, it is your responsibility as the coach to remain in control. Whenever you feel annoyed, it is a great suggestion to temporarily push pause, take a breath and think before you act. Heckling the players or getting belligerent is not only unprofessional, but it sets a bad example for the remainder of the football team and gives them the excuse to act in the same way.
